#4df0c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4df0c8 is composed of 30.2% red, 94.1%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 165.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 62.2%. #4df0c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00e191.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4df0c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4df0c8 has RGB values of R:77, G:240,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5107912.

Shades and Tints of #4df0c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f0f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4df0c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97a6a2 is the less saturated color, while #3effd0 is the most saturated one.
